Abstract

A system of processing data relation among three parties includes a host computer and a terminal device. The host computer includes a motherboard, and a hard disk, a memory, and a processor disposed on the motherboard and electrically connected to the motherboard. The host computer is configured to store a website system, and a member management system, a registration system, and a pairing detection system connected to the website system. The terminal device is connected to the host computer through a wired network or a wireless network to access the website system, the member management system, or the registration system of the host computer. The terminal device is a personal computer, a notebook computer, a tablet computer, or a smart phone.

本創作提供一種三方資料關係的處理方法可針對學生(及其家長)、學校、及教師三方之間彼此找學校、找教師、及找學生等三大用途。 This creation provides a three-way data relationship treatment method for students (and their parents), schools, and teachers to find schools, find teachers, and find students.

圖5顯示本創作的三方資料關係的處理方法。 Figure 5 shows how the three-party data relationship of this creation is handled.

本創作的三方資料關係的處理方法的多個步驟包括: The multiple steps of the method for processing the tripartite data relationship of the present creation include:

步驟S1:讀取屬於需求族群的需求方的需求方資料集,需求方資料集包括W個需求參數及資格參數。 Step S1: Read the demand side data set of the demand side belonging to the demand group, and the demand side data set includes W demand parameters and qualification parameters.

在此,需求族群可能包括多個學生,需求方即為在該些學生中的一名學生。需求方資料集則可包括學生的個人資料。 Here, the demand group may include a plurality of students, and the demand side is one of the students. The demand side data set can include the student's personal data.

W個需求參數可為學生對於教學需求所設定的條件,包括但不限於科目、科目等級、上課方式、上課時間、上課人數、上課學校(或補習班)、上課環境(或設備)、教師學歷、教師經歷、及教師性別,以此例而言,W等於10。至於資格參數會在下文中加以說明。 W requirements parameters can be set for students' requirements for teaching needs, including but not limited to subjects, subject level, class style, class time, number of students, class (or cram school), class environment (or equipment), teacher qualifications , teacher experience, and teacher gender, for example, W is equal to 10. The qualification parameters will be explained below.

步驟S2:讀取屬於機構族群的機構方的機構方資料集,機構方資料集包括X個未定參數及Y個已定參數。 Step S2: reading the institutional party data set of the organization party belonging to the institutional group, the organization side data set includes X undetermined parameters and Y determined parameters.

在此,機構族群可為多個學校;廣義而言,凡是有師資需求之處,無論是體制內或體制外,公立或私立,包括但不限於普通學校、補習班、營隊、或課後照護教學中心等,皆為本創作所稱的學校。以擁有或執行本創作的三方 資料關係的處理方法的電子業務模式平台的主體的觀點而言,機構族群可區分為聯盟校或直營校。機構方即為在該些學校中的一所學校,而機構方資料集則可包括學校的登記資料。 Here, the institutional group can be a plurality of schools; in a broad sense, where there are faculty needs, whether within the system or outside the system, public or private, including but not limited to ordinary schools, cram schools, camps, or after school The care center, etc., are all schools called the creation. To own or perform the three parties of this creation In terms of the main body of the electronic business model platform for processing data relationships, the institutional group can be divided into a federation school or a direct marketing school. The institution is the one of the schools, and the institutional data set can include the school registration information.

X個未定參數可為學校對於教學需求所設定的條件,包括但不限於科目、科目等級、上課方式、上課時間、教師學歷、教師經歷、及教師性別,以此例而言,X等於7。 The X undetermined parameters can be the conditions set by the school for teaching needs, including but not limited to subjects, subject grades, class style, class time, teacher qualifications, teacher experience, and teacher gender. For example, X is equal to 7.

Y個已定參數可為學校有能力提供學生以滿足其教學需求的條件,包括但不限於不限於上課人數、上課學校(或補習班)、及上課環境(或設備),以此例而言,Y等於3。 Y established parameters may be conditions for the school to provide students with the ability to meet their teaching needs, including but not limited to, not limited to the number of students attending classes, school (or cram school), and classroom environment (or equipment), for example , Y is equal to 3.

步驟S3:讀取屬於供給族群的供給方的供給方資料集,供給方資料集包括Z個供給參數。 Step S3: Read the supplier data set belonging to the supplier of the supply group, and the supplier data set includes Z supply parameters.

在此,供給族群可能是多個教師,例如全職的專任教師或兼職的兼任教師,而退休教師、補教教師或自營家教班的教師亦可包括在內。供給方即為在該些教師中的一名教師,而供給方資料集則可包括教師的個人資料。 Here, the supply group may be a plurality of teachers, such as full-time full-time teachers or part-time part-time teachers, and retired teachers, supplementary teachers, or self-employed tutors may also be included. The supplier is one of the teachers, and the supplier data set can include the teacher's personal data.

Z個供給參數可為教師有能力提供學生或學校以滿足其教學需求的條件,包括但不限於不限於科目、科目等級、上課方式、上課時間、教師學歷、教師經歷、及教師性別,以此例而言,Z等於7。 Z supply parameters may be conditions for teachers to provide students or schools to meet their teaching needs, including but not limited to subjects, subject grades, class styles, class time, teacher qualifications, teacher experience, and teacher gender. For example, Z is equal to 7.

其中,W、X、Y與Z皆為自然數,W小於或等於Y與Z的相加,且X小於或等於Z。 Wherein, W, X, Y and Z are all natural numbers, W is less than or equal to the addition of Y and Z, and X is less than or equal to Z.

如此,舉例而言,學生會先提出尋求教學的W個需求參數,該W個參數可區分為第一階段即受到滿足的W1個需求參數及第二階段才受到滿足的W2個需求參數,亦即W=W1+W2。可能有學校提出Y個已定參數,足以滿足該 W1個需求參數,故W1小於或等於Y。然而,學校可能不具備足夠的師資,以便滿足剩餘的該W2個參數。在這種情況下,學校會再提出尋求師資的X個未定參數,且X等於W2。可能有教師提出Z個供給參數,足以滿足該X個未定參數,故X小於或等於Z,亦即W1小於或等於Z。綜之,W=W1+W2Y+Z。 Thus, for example, the student first proposes W demand parameters for seeking teaching, and the W parameters can be divided into W1 demand parameters that are satisfied in the first stage and W2 demand parameters that are satisfied in the second stage, that is, W=W1+W2. There may be schools that have proposed Y parameters that are sufficient to satisfy the W1 demand parameters, so W1 is less than or equal to Y. However, the school may not have enough teachers to meet the remaining W2 parameters. In this case, the school will again propose X undetermined parameters for seeking teachers, and X is equal to W2. There may be teachers who propose Z supply parameters, which are sufficient to satisfy the X undetermined parameters, so X is less than or equal to Z, that is, W1 is less than or equal to Z. In summary, W=W1+W2 Y+Z.

步驟S4:將該W個需求參數分別比對於該Y個已定參數與該Z個供給參數;並將該X個未定參數分別比對於該Z個供給參數。 Step S4: comparing the W demand parameters to the Z determined parameters and the Z supply parameters respectively; and comparing the X undetermined parameters to the Z supply parameters respectively.

首先,在形式判斷階段,如果W大於Y與Z的相加,顯然表示W不可能受到滿足,則配對不可能成功。在這種情況下,除了顯示配對不成功的訊息之外,可提示供給方修改需求參數。例如,學生可退而求其次,將W個需求參數減少成W’個需求參數,直到配對成功為止。較佳地,可提示需求方移除特定需求參數。更佳地,可假設需求方已移除特定需求參數而進行比對,再提示需求方該比對是在假設已移除特定需求參數的情況下所進行的。 First, in the form judgment stage, if W is greater than the addition of Y and Z, it is apparent that W cannot be satisfied, and the pairing cannot be successful. In this case, in addition to displaying a message that the pairing is unsuccessful, the supplier may be prompted to modify the demand parameter. For example, students can retreat to reduce the W demand parameters to W' demand parameters until the pairing is successful. Preferably, the demanding party can be prompted to remove specific demand parameters. More preferably, it can be assumed that the demand side has removed the specific demand parameters for comparison, and then prompts the demanding party to perform the comparison, assuming that the specific demand parameters have been removed.

其次,在實際判斷階段,是判斷W個需求參數的數值或字串是否符合Y個已定參數的數值或字串,進而X個未定參數的數值或字串是否符合Z個供給參數的數值或字串。 Secondly, in the actual judgment stage, it is judged whether the value or string of the W demand parameters conforms to the value or string of the Y determined parameters, and whether the value or string of the X undetermined parameters meets the values of the Z supply parameters or String.

較佳地,各種參數可設定有順序關係或集合關係,例如,以科目等級而言,可從事高年級教學的教師亦可從事低年級的教學。 Preferably, various parameters may be set in a sequence relationship or a set relationship. For example, in terms of subject level, teachers who can engage in higher grade teaching may also engage in lower grade teaching.

作為一種替代實施例,可對於各參數來設定容忍範圍,雖然某已定參數不足以滿足某需求參數,但前者很接近後者,而處於該容忍範圍,則暫時視為配對成功,仍然將該筆比對結果顯示出來。例如,以上課人數而言,如果一名學生希望一個班級的上課人數不超過9人,但目前該班級的上課人數為10 人(算入該名學生),雖然不滿足,但甚為接近該學生的需求,故仍然將該班級顯示出來。 As an alternative embodiment, the tolerance range can be set for each parameter. Although a certain parameter is insufficient to meet a certain requirement parameter, the former is very close to the latter, and in the tolerance range, the pairing is temporarily considered as a successful pairing. The comparison results are displayed. For example, in terms of the number of students in the above class, if a student wants to have no more than 9 students in a class, the number of students in the class is currently 10 The person (calculated into the student), although not satisfied, is very close to the student's needs, so the class is still displayed.

步驟S5:根據步驟S4的比對結果,判斷需求方是否成功配對於機構方與供給方;若成功配對,則暫存成功配對訊息,並根據成功配對訊息,將需求方的需求方允許公開資料寫入至機構方資料集與供給方資料集。 Step S5: judging whether the demand side is successfully matched to the organization side and the supplier side according to the comparison result of step S4; if the pairing is successful, the successful pairing message is temporarily stored, and according to the successful pairing message, the demand side of the demand side is allowed to disclose the data. Write to the organization side data set and the supplier side data set.

在此,需求方允許公開資料是例如學生的姓名或電話,至於身分證字號或住址則可列為需求方非允許公開資料。需求方允許公開資料可在入口網站1的「會員管理系統」2的「資料維護」中編輯或設定是否允許公開,亦可設定公開對象(學校或教師)。 Here, the demand side allows the public information to be, for example, the student's name or telephone number, and the identity card number or address can be listed as the non-permitted public information of the demand side. The demand side allows the public information to be edited or set in the "Profile Maintenance" of the "Member Management System" of the portal site 1 to determine whether or not to allow the disclosure, or to set the public object (school or teacher).

(選擇性或較佳的特徵) (selective or preferred feature)

選擇性地,本創作的三方資料關係的處理方法更包括由電腦主機所執行的步驟S6:由需求方、機構方或供給方將給付完成資料同時寫入至需求方資料集、機構方資料集與供給方資料集三者。 Optionally, the processing method of the three-party data relationship of the creation further includes step S6 performed by the computer host: the demand side, the organization side or the supplier side simultaneously writes the payment completion data to the demand side data set and the organization side data set. Three with the supply side data set.

在此,所謂「給付完成」可包括上課完成或付款完成。在上課完成的例子中,學生在完成特定課程後,該特定課程應該紀錄下來,避免重複修課。此外,完成該特定課程意味著學生能力的提升,給付完成(上課完成)資料可作為一門進階課程的一道憑證,而擁有該憑證的學生始可修習該進階課程。 Here, the "payment completion" may include the completion of the class or the completion of the payment. In the example completed in class, after the student completes a specific course, the specific course should be recorded to avoid repeating the course. In addition, completion of the particular course means an improvement in the student's ability, and the completion of the payment (scheduled completion of the course) information can be used as a voucher for an advanced course, and the student who owns the voucher can begin the advanced course.

選擇性地,本創作的三方資料關係的處理方法更包括由電腦主機所執行的步驟S7:判斷需求方資料集的資格參數是否超過預設的資格門檻;若超過,則除了原本的需求族群之外,更將需求方資料集歸類於供給族群。 Optionally, the processing method of the three-party data relationship of the creation further includes step S7 performed by the computer host: determining whether the qualification parameter of the demand side data set exceeds a preset qualification threshold; if exceeded, the original demand group is In addition, the demand side data set is classified into the supply group.

一種較佳的情形是,完成特定課程的學生,已獲得該特定課程所欲培養的能力,未來即有可能擔任該特定課程的教師。 A preferred situation is that a student who has completed a particular course has acquired the ability to develop that particular course, and in the future it is possible to serve as a teacher for that particular course.

步驟S7的目的在於實現德國式的師徒制教育,因為教育除了知識的傳播之外,教學經驗的傳承亦甚為重要。如果學生修習過多個指定課程,累積足夠知識與經驗,進而具備授課資格,則原本屬於需求族群的學生,可列入供給族群,成為種子教師。然而,縱使學生具備授課資格,其仍然可能選擇繼續修習學業,故不因此將其移除自需求族群。此外,種子教師的追蹤管理在時間上可能長達數年,在空間上可能延伸至數個縣市,且種子教師所具備的能力亦持續增長變化,因此,確實有必要透過本創作的三方資料關係的處理方法所提供的步驟S7來達成這種追蹤管理。 The purpose of step S7 is to achieve a German-style apprenticeship education, because in addition to the dissemination of knowledge, the inheritance of teaching experience is also very important. If a student has taken a number of designated courses, accumulated sufficient knowledge and experience, and is qualified to teach, students who originally belonged to the demand group can be included in the supply group and become seed teachers. However, even if students are qualified to teach, they may still choose to continue their studies, so they are not removed from the demand group. In addition, the tracking management of seed teachers may last for several years, and may extend to several counties and cities in space, and the capacity of seed teachers continues to grow and change. Therefore, it is indeed necessary to use the three-party data of this creation. The step S7 provided by the processing method of the relationship achieves such tracking management.

選擇性地,在本創作的三方資料關係的處理方法中,步驟S7是在執行步驟S6特定次數後執行。 Optionally, in the processing method of the three-way data relationship of the present creation, step S7 is performed after performing the step S6 a certain number of times.

舉例而言,可能必須修習多個指定課程始可列入種子師資。由於每完成一個指定課程,就會執行步驟S6,故完成多個指定課程,就會執行步驟S6多次。 For example, it may be necessary to take a number of designated courses to be included in the seed faculty. Since each of the specified courses is completed, step S6 is performed, so that when a plurality of designated courses are completed, step S6 is performed a plurality of times.

選擇性地,在本創作的三方資料關係的處理方法中,資格參數在步驟S6後發生遞增,且遞增的幅度是由該W個需求參數所決定。 Optionally, in the processing method of the three-party data relationship of the present creation, the qualification parameter is incremented after step S6, and the magnitude of the increment is determined by the W demand parameters.

選擇性地,在本創作的三方資料關係的處理方法中,資格參數是由學生試題(Student-Problem,SP)表分析所決定,其中,SP表分析包括S曲線,其為多個學生的答對試題數的依序排列所形成者,及P曲線,其為多個試題的答對學生數的依序排列所形成者。 Optionally, in the processing method of the three-way data relationship of the present creation, the qualification parameter is determined by the Student-Problem (SP) table analysis, wherein the SP table analysis includes the S-curve, which is a correct answer for multiple students. The sequence of the number of test questions is formed by the sequential arrangement, and the P curve, which is formed by the sequential arrangement of the number of correct students of the plurality of test questions.

選擇性地,在本創作的三方資料關係的處理方法中,資格參數對於該W個需求參數形成邊界。 Optionally, in the processing method of the three-way data relationship of the present creation, the qualification parameter forms a boundary for the W demand parameters.

所謂的課程不只限於針對學生的教學課程,亦可包括針對種子教師的培訓課程。因此,誠如前述,在入口網站1的「產品管理」頁面中,設置有「培訓」課程子頁面,以供種子教師瀏覽。換句話說,種子教師在培訓課程中具有學生的身分。為了提升師資培訓的品質,多個培訓課程亦應該有層級之分,培訓課程的內容可表示成W個需求參數。種子教師受限於其現有的資格參數,無法將該W個需求參數設定成過高或特殊條件,亦即,資格參數對於該W個需求形成邊界。種子師資必須完成基礎培訓課程,才可進一步修習進階課程。 The so-called courses are not limited to teaching courses for students, but also include training courses for seed teachers. Therefore, as mentioned above, in the "Product Management" page of Portal 1, there is a "Training" course subpage for the seed teacher to browse. In other words, the seed teacher has the identity of the student in the training course. In order to improve the quality of teacher training, multiple training courses should also be divided into levels. The content of the training courses can be expressed as W demand parameters. The seed teacher is limited by its existing qualification parameters and cannot set the W demand parameters to be too high or special conditions, that is, the qualification parameters form a boundary for the W requirements. The seed teacher must complete the basic training course in order to further the advanced course.

據此,資格參數及其對於該W個需求參數所形成的邊界亦可用於實現教師的評鑑機制及進階機制,甚至簽約或保證金功能亦可實現,因為契約的存滅可為二元量化,而保證金的多寡則為數值量化,在聘用新人教師或代課教師時,它們可確保教學品質。 Accordingly, the qualification parameters and the boundaries formed by the W demand parameters can also be used to implement the teacher evaluation mechanism and the advanced mechanism, and even the contract or margin function can be realized, because the existence of the contract can be binary quantization. And the amount of margin is numerically quantified, which ensures the quality of teaching when hiring new teachers or substitute teachers.

選擇性地,在本創作的三方資料關係的處理方法中,該些步驟S1至S5是根據需求方自終端機所傳送的配對指令集而啟動。 Optionally, in the processing method of the three-party data relationship of the present creation, the steps S1 to S5 are started according to the pairing instruction set transmitted by the demander from the terminal.

誠如前述,本創作的三方資料關係的處理方法可由進入上述報名系統3來啟動,具體而言,可在報名系統3的網頁上設置按鈕、選單或輸入框來輔助配對指令集的生成。 As described above, the processing method of the three-party data relationship of the present creation can be initiated by entering the registration system 3. Specifically, a button, a menu or an input box can be set on the webpage of the registration system 3 to assist in the generation of the pairing instruction set.

選擇性地,在本創作的三方資料關係的處理方法中,需求方資料集更包括輔助方權限欄位,其記載有輔助方,以允許輔助方自終端機來傳送配對指令集而啟動該些步驟S1至S5,及修改需求方資料集。 Optionally, in the processing method of the three-party data relationship of the present creation, the demand side data set further includes an auxiliary party permission field, wherein the auxiliary party is recorded to allow the auxiliary party to transmit the pairing instruction set from the terminal device to start the Steps S1 to S5, and modifying the demand side data set.

在此,輔助方例如是學生的家長。姓名記載於輔助方權限欄位的家長即可代替學生進入報名系統3,選填其需求,進一步經由檢測配對系統4找到適合的學校及師資課程。同時,其亦擁有修改學生的個人資料的權限。 Here, the assistant is, for example, the parent of the student. Parents whose names are recorded in the Auxiliary Party's permission field can replace the student's entry into the registration system 3, select their needs, and further find suitable school and teacher courses through the test matching system 4. At the same time, it also has the authority to modify the student's personal data.

選擇性地,在本創作的三方資料關係的處理方法中,需求方資料集、機構方資料集與供給方資料集的一部或全部是由電腦主機來處理成顯示在網站中,網站包括禁止訪客變更頁面、允許訪客變更頁面及配對登錄頁面。 Optionally, in the processing method of the three-party data relationship of the creation, one or all of the demand side data set, the institutional side data set and the supply side data set are processed by the computer host to be displayed on the website, and the website includes prohibition. Guest change page, allow guest change page, and paired login page.

上述網站即為入口網站1,其中,配對登錄頁面即為報名系統3的頁面;允許訪客變更頁面即為「會員管理系統」2的「會員專區」頁面的「資料維護」子頁面;其餘則為禁止訪客變更頁面。 The above website is the portal website 1, wherein the pairing login page is the page of the registration system 3; the permission change page is the "data maintenance" subpage of the "member area" page of the "member management system" 2; the rest is Visitors are not allowed to change the page.
